Titan Quest Overview

Begin an epic journey in Titan Quest, an action RPG set in Ancient Egypt, Greece, and Asia. The main story, the bosses, and the NPCs are infused with Greek mythology. As a hero, players must kill each titan that has escaped its prison to save mankind. Create a character and choose two Masteries from a pool of eight to make a class, with over 35 classes available (i.e. choosing the Spirit and Dream Masteries will yield the Diviner class). Hack-n-slash mobs to pieces with a variety of weapons and complete campaign quests to gain experience, get loot, and level up. Team up with friends and form a party of up to six people to play together. Create your own maps and quests with the World Editor.

Titan Quest Additional Information

Developer(s): Iron Lore Entertainment
Publisher(s): THQ (2006 - 2016); THQ Nordic (2016 - present)
Composer(s): Scott Morton and Michael Verrette

Game Engine: PathEngine

Language(s): English, Russian, French, Polish, German, Italian, Spanish, Czech, Japanese, Korean, Chinese

Platform(s): PC, iOS, Android

PC Release Date: June 26, 2006
iOS Release Date: May 19, 2016
Android Release Date: July 7, 2016
10-Year Anniversary Edition Release Date: August 31, 2016

Expansions:

  1. Titan Quest Immortal Throne - March 2, 2007

Development History / Background:

Titan Quest is an action RPG that was developed by Iron Lore Entertainment and originally published by THQ for its June 2006 release for PC. THQ remained the main publisher from 2006 to 2016, save for a Steam release of Titan Quest in 2007. THQ then teamed up with Nordic Games and formed THQ Nordic to publish the tenth anniversary edition of the game, released in August 2016. The anniversary edition combines both the Titan Quest and Titan Quest Immortal Throne games, promising over 1200 changes. 

DotEmu was responsible for the initial mobile ports of Titan Quest for the iOS and Android platforms in 2016. Then THQ Nordic published the subsequent versions of the game.
